## What is the Architecture of Dedicated Chains?

Dedicated Chains represent a specialized blockchain infrastructure designed to support specific decentralized applications or protocols, diverging from the generalized approach of public blockchains. This architectural choice prioritizes performance and customization, enabling tailored consensus mechanisms and virtual machine configurations to optimize for particular use cases within the cryptocurrency ecosystem. Consequently, these chains often exhibit enhanced throughput and reduced latency compared to broader networks, facilitating complex financial derivatives and options trading. The development of Dedicated Chains necessitates careful consideration of security trade-offs, as a narrower validator set can potentially increase centralization risks, demanding robust governance frameworks.

## What is the Application of Dedicated Chains?

Within options trading and financial derivatives, Dedicated Chains facilitate the creation of decentralized exchanges (DEXs) and automated market makers (AMMs) optimized for complex contract specifications. These applications benefit from the deterministic execution environment and reduced gas costs inherent in a purpose-built blockchain, enabling sophisticated pricing models and settlement mechanisms. The application of Dedicated Chains extends to collateralization protocols, allowing for the efficient management and verification of assets backing derivative positions, enhancing capital efficiency. Furthermore, they support the development of novel financial instruments, such as perpetual swaps and exotic options, previously impractical on generalized blockchain platforms.

## What is the Algorithm of Dedicated Chains?

The algorithmic foundation of Dedicated Chains often incorporates variations of Proof-of-Stake (PoS) or Delegated Proof-of-Stake (DPoS) to achieve consensus, prioritizing speed and scalability over the energy consumption associated with Proof-of-Work (PoW). Selection of the appropriate consensus algorithm is critical, balancing security requirements with the need for rapid transaction finality essential for derivatives trading. Smart contract execution within these chains frequently leverages WebAssembly (Wasm) or similar virtual machines, enabling developers to deploy complex financial logic efficiently. The algorithmic design also encompasses mechanisms for on-chain governance, allowing stakeholders to propose and implement changes to the protocol parameters, adapting to evolving market conditions.
